在数字化时代,高效互动体验已成为企业提升竞争力、增强用户粘性的关键。而框架与客户端的完美融合,则是实现这一目标的重要途径。本文将深入探讨框架与客户端融合的原理、实践方法以及如何打造高效互动体验。
一、框架与客户端融合的原理
1.1 框架的作用
框架(Framework)为开发者提供了一套标准的开发环境,包括编程语言、库、工具和规范等。它可以帮助开发者快速构建应用程序,提高开发效率。
1.2 客户端的作用
客户端(Client)是用户与应用程序交互的界面。它负责接收用户输入,处理数据,并将结果显示给用户。在移动端、PC端等不同设备上,客户端的形式和功能也有所不同。
1.3 融合原理
框架与客户端的融合,旨在实现以下目标:
- 提高开发效率:框架提供了一套标准化的开发流程,减少重复劳动。
- 优化用户体验:融合后的应用程序可以更好地适应不同设备和场景,提供流畅的交互体验。
- 降低维护成本:框架可以简化应用程序的维护工作,提高稳定性。
二、框架与客户端融合的实践方法
2.1 选择合适的框架
选择合适的框架是融合的基础。以下是一些常见的框架:
- 前端框架:React、Vue、Angular等
- 后端框架:Spring、Django、Laravel等
2.2 设计合理的架构
合理的架构可以确保框架与客户端之间的协同工作。以下是一些常见的架构模式:
- MVC(Model-View-Controller):将应用程序分为模型、视图和控制器三个部分,实现数据、界面和逻辑的分离。
- MVVM(Model-View-ViewModel):与MVC类似,但将视图和控制器合并为ViewModel,简化开发流程。
2.3 优化性能
性能是影响用户体验的重要因素。以下是一些优化性能的方法:
- 代码优化:减少不必要的计算和DOM操作,提高代码执行效率。
- 资源压缩:压缩图片、CSS和JavaScript等资源,减少加载时间。
- 缓存机制:合理使用缓存,提高数据访问速度。
三、打造高效互动体验的关键
3.1 关注用户需求
了解用户需求是打造高效互动体验的前提。以下是一些了解用户需求的方法:
- 用户调研:通过问卷调查、访谈等方式,了解用户需求和痛点。
- 数据分析:分析用户行为数据,发现用户需求的变化趋势。
3.2 优化交互设计
交互设计是影响用户体验的关键因素。以下是一些优化交互设计的方法:
- 简洁明了:界面设计简洁明了,方便用户快速找到所需功能。
- 响应迅速:应用程序响应迅速,减少用户等待时间。
- 视觉美观:界面设计美观大方,提升用户体验。
3.3 不断迭代优化
高效互动体验并非一蹴而就,需要不断迭代优化。以下是一些迭代优化的方法:
- 用户反馈:收集用户反馈,及时调整产品功能和设计。
- 数据分析:分析用户行为数据,发现潜在问题,进行优化。
四、总结
框架与客户端的完美融合,是打造高效互动体验的关键。通过选择合适的框架、设计合理的架构、优化性能、关注用户需求、优化交互设计以及不断迭代优化,我们可以打造出令人满意的应用程序,提升用户体验。在这个过程中,我们需要不断学习、实践和总结,为用户提供更好的服务。
